About the company:

Factorial Energy is an American solid-state battery company headquartered in Billerica, Massachusetts, focused on developing high-performance energy storage solutions for electric mobility, defense, and AI-driven robotics applications. The company designs and manufactures solid-state batteries that overcome the fundamental limitations of conventional lithium-ion technology, including energy density constraints, weight penalties, and safety concerns associated with liquid electrolytes. Factorial's batteries have demonstrated real-world capability, including powering a vehicle on a drive exceeding 1,200 kilometers on a single charge using solid-state cells. Factorial's mission centers on advancing American technology leadership, economic resilience, and domestic industrialization of next-generation battery technology. The company positions its work as critical to U.S. national security, energy independence, and global competitiveness across the automotive, defense, and robotics sectors. With over 10 years of research and development and more than 150 patents and patent applications, Factorial has built a deep intellectual property portfolio and established partnerships with four top-tier automotive manufacturers, including Stellantis. What distinguishes Factorial is its capital-efficient manufacturing approach: its technology is approximately 80 percent drop-in compatible with existing lithium-ion production infrastructure, significantly reducing the cost and disruption required for partners to transition to solid-state production. The company also employs a proprietary dry-coating process to further enhance manufacturing efficiency and reduce costs. Recent milestones include securing its first commercial aerospace battery order and completing successful flight tests with partner Tulip.

The Opportunity

Factorial Energy is seeking an Assembly Equipment Technician to join our Cheonan, South Korea site. This role takes charge of daily operation, troubleshooting, routine maintenance, and minor optimization of core assembly equipment, including Notching, Stacking, Welding, and Sealing machines for Silicon Power Cell pouch cell lines. The incumbent will conduct on-site equipment debugging, abnormality disposal, regular preventive maintenance, support pilot trials and mass production ramp-up, assist engineers in equipment retrofitting and parameter verification, and maintain stable running of assembly stations. You will operate in a fast-growing, early-stage battery manufacturing environment with cross-functional global collaboration.

 

In this role, you will:

  • Perform daily startup inspections, routine preventive maintenance, and breakdown troubleshooting for Notching, Stacking, Ultrasonic Welding, and Sealing assembly equipment to minimize unplanned downtime.
  • Complete regular equipment lubrication, part replacement, fixture cleaning, and calibration
  • Record maintenance logs, equipment failure data, and spare parts consumption records completely.
  • Adjust basic machine process parameters, positioning coordinates, tension, and compaction pressure on site to mitigate common defects such as stacking misalignment, tab welding void, sealing leakage, and notching burr.
  • Assist equipment engineers in prototype debugging, FAT/SAT on-site acceptance, EVT/DVT/PVT pilot tests, NPI new product trials, and mass production parameter verification.
  • Cooperate with production, process, and quality teams to handle on-site equipment abnormalities, follow up on improvement actions, and support CAPA implementation for recurring machine issues.
  • Support minor equipment retrofits, fixture replacement, and multi-spec pouch cell product changeover; feed back equipment structural and functional defects to vendors and the engineering team.
  • Monitor real-time equipment running status, collect abnormal data, summarize recurring failure modes, and propose simple optimization suggestions to improve line OEE and production yield.
  • Strictly follow equipment SOP, safety operation rules, and IATF 16949 on-site management requirements to standardize daily equipment operation and maintenance work.

We are looking for people who:

  • College diploma or above, majoring in Mechatronics, Mechanical Maintenance, Electrical Automation, or related technical disciplines.
  • 2+ years of hands-on maintenance experience in a lithium battery assembly workshop, familiar with Notching, Stacking, Tab Welding, or Cell Sealing automation equipment.
  • Able to independently complete equipment daily maintenance, breakdown diagnosis, and on-site minor adjustments; understand basic servo, cylinder, CCD positioning, and pneumatic/hydraulic control principles.
  • Capable of reading simple mechanical and electrical sketches; proficient in fixture disassembly, assembly, and replacement.
  • Familiar with workshop 5S, equipment maintenance record management, and able to fill maintenance, failure, and production shift logs accurately.
  • Strong on-site problem response capability; able to cooperate cross-functionally with production, quality and engineering staff.
  • Basic English reading ability for equipment operation manuals and simple technical instructions; basic Chinese communication capability is preferred.
  • Able to work shift schedules, adapt to a mass production workshop working environment, and possess strong safety awareness and execution ability.

 

Preferred Qualifications

  • Rich hands-on experience maintaining full set assembly line equipment covering Notching, Stacking, Welding and Sealing processes.
  • Working experience in battery manufacturers with mass production stacking & sealing line maintenance background.
  • Practical experience supporting silicon anode / high-expansion electrode pouch cell assembly equipment debugging and maintenance.
  • Experience supporting pilot line trial production and equipment transfer from lab to mass workshop.
  • Basic knowledge of IATF 16949 workshop site management, PFMEA, and equipment abnormality closed-loop management.
